Effect of Solid Loadings and Urea addition on Biogas production from the Co-Digestion of Rice Straw with Cow Dung

I.J. Ona, N. Surma, R. Ogah, A. Olawoyin and M.S. Iorungwa

Abstract:

Effect of Solid Loadings and Urea addition on Biogas production from the Co-Digestion of Rice Straw with Cow Dung

This paper investigated the anaerobic co-digestion of RS and CD at lower solid loadings of 5, 10% and 15% TS. It also studied the effect of urea addition on biogas yields after 20 days retention time. These experiments were also carried out at different substrate mixing ratios of RS-CD 1:1 and RS-CD 1:2. The anaerobic digestion was carried out in a digester designed and fabricated locally with retention time of between 40-60 days with results showing a maximum biogas yield of 116 L/kg TS and 104 L/kg TS for 10% TS at RS-CD 1:2 and RS-CD 1:1 respectively. Experiments carried out at 15% TS showed the lowest biogas yield of 72.1 L/kg and 81.2 L/kg for RS-CD 1:1 and RS-CD 1:2 respectively. Results also showed that studies carried out at RS-CD 1:1 showed higher biogas yields for substrate concentrations of 5%, 10 % and 15% TS when compared to corresponding experiments carried out at a mixing ratio of RS-CD 1:2. This study also showed that supplementing the anaerobic digestion with 0.5% urea increased biogas yield by 15-19%.
